NDdeTrustedShareEnum 函数

[不再支持网络 DDE。 windows Vista 上存在Nddeapi.dll,但所有函数调用都返回NDDE_NOT_IMPLEMENTED。]

检索调用进程的上下文中受信任的所有网络 DDE 共享的名称。

语法

UINT NDdeTrustedShareEnum(
  _In_  LPTSTR  lpszServer,
  _In_  UINT    nLevel,
  _Out_ LPBYTE  lpBuffer,
  _In_  DWORD   cBufSize,
  _Out_ LPDWORD lpnEntriesRead,
  _Out_ LPDWORD lpcbTotalAvailable
);

参数

lpszServer [in]

DSDM 所在的服务器的名称。

nLevel [in]

保留。 此参数必须为零。

lpBuffer [out]

指向接收受信任 DDE 共享列表的缓冲区的指针。 受信任的 DDE 共享列表作为一系列以 null 分隔的字符串返回,结尾处以双 null 字符结尾。 此参数可以为 NULL。 如果 lpBufferNULL,则 DSDM 将返回在 lTotalTotalAvailable 字段中保存共享列表所需的缓冲区大小。

cBufSize [in]

lpBuffer 缓冲区的大小(以字节为单位)。 如果 lpBuffer 为 NULL,则此参数必须为

lpnEntriesRead [out]

指向接收要枚举的受信任共享总数的变量的指针。 此参数不能为 NULL

ltotalAvailable [out]

指向变量的指针,该变量接收存储受信任 DDE 共享列表所需的总字节数。 此参数不能为 NULL

返回值

如果函数成功,则返回值NDDE_NO_ERROR。

如果函数失败,则返回值为错误代码,可通过调用 NDdeGetErrorString 将其转换为文本错误消息。 如果 lpBuffer 参数为 NULL,则返回NDDE_BUF_TOO_SMALL。

要求

要求
最低受支持的客户端
Windows 2000 Professional [仅限桌面应用]
最低受支持的服务器
Windows 2000 Server [仅限桌面应用]
标头
Nddeapi.h

Nddeapi.lib
DLL
Nddeapi.dll
Unicode 和 ANSI 名称
NDdeTrustedShareEnumW (Unicode) 和 NDdeTrustedShareEnumA (ANSI)

另请参阅

网络动态数据交换概述

网络 DDE 函数